Autor | Zpráva | ||
---|---|---|---|
quinux Profil |
#1 · Zasláno: 1. 7. 2006, 23:00:45 · Upravil/a: quinux
Zdravím,
už 3 hodiny přemýšlím nad problémem, který mi nastal u rozbalovacího menu v IE (jinde funguje). Mám totiž pod menu nadpis, který je tvořen klasickým image replacementem tedy: <h1 id="kontakty">Kontakty<span></span></h1> CSS k tomu: #mainContentIn h1#kontakty {background:#ee3338;color:#fff;font-size:1.1em;text-align:right;width: 548px;height:48px;line-height:48px;position:relative;display:block;ove rflow:hidden} #mainContentIn h1#kontakty span {background:#ee3338 url(../img/cats/kontakty.gif) no-repeat;color:#fff;font-size:1.1em;text-align:right;width:548px;heig ht:48px;line-height:48px;position:absolute;top:0;left:0;display:block} bohužel při rozbalení menu mi tento nadpis toto menu překrývá a ať dělám co dělám tak tomu nemůžu zabránit. Kód menu <ul> <li id="menu7"><a href="#">Poradci<span></span></a> <ul> <li><a href="poradci/primy-prodej.html">Přímý prodej</a></li> <li><a href="poradci/prilezitost.html">Příležitost</a></li> <li><a href="poradci/zacatek-uspechu.html">Začátek úspěchu</a></li> <li><a href="poradci/fotogalerie.html">Fotogalerie</a></li> <li><a href="poradci/vseobecne-obchodni-podminky.html">Všeobecné obchodní podmínky</a></li> <li><a href="poradci/prihlasit-se.html">Přihlásit se – Poradci Online</a></li> </ul> </li> </ul> a CSS: #menu7 {background:url(../img/poradciOff.gif) no-repeat;width:79px;height:38px;float:left;} #menu7 a {background:url(../img/poradciOff.gif) no-repeat;display:block;width:79px;height:38px;z-index:0;overflow:hidd en} #menu7 a span {display:block;position:absolute;width:79px;height:38px;background:url (../img/poradciOff.gif) no-repeat;top:0;left:0;cursor:pointer} #menu7 a:hover span {background:url(../img/poradciOn.gif) no-repeat;} #mainMenu {position:relative} #mainMenu li ul { position:absolute;width:13em;z-index:10;list-style-type:none;text-ali gn:left;font-size:.7em;color:#fff; left:-999em; } #mainMenu li ul li {border:1px solid #fff;border-top:0;z-index:10;padding:3px 10px 3px 3px} #mainMenu li ul ul {z-index:10 !important;margin: -1.9em 0 0 18em;} #mainMenu li:hover ul ul, #mainMenu li.sfhover ul ul { left: -999em;z-index:10 !important;display:block} #mainMenu li:hover ul, #mainMenu li li:hover ul, #mainMenu li.sfhover ul, #mainMenu li li.sfhover ul {left:auto;z-index:10important;display:block} K menu je samozřejmně potřeba javascript. Za každou radu budu vděčný. Díky PS: z-index jsem zkoušel ve všech podobách a všude |
||
Jan Tvrdík Profil |
#2 · Zasláno: 2. 7. 2006, 07:24:17
Kdybys poslal celej zdroj bylo by to jednodušší. Teď abych to skládal do hromady.
|
||
Časová prodleva: 18 let
|
Toto téma je uzamčeno. Odpověď nelze zaslat.
0